.31 percussion caliber with a 6" barrel. Manufactured in 1862. Standard features include 6" barrel, five shot, single action, percussion, varnished walnut grips, and plated brass back strap and trigger guard. This revolver left the factory in either nickel or tin plated as both the frame and barrel legends are devoid of this finish. The barrel retains traces of this plating with the balance mixing well to a shiny gun metal appearance. The frame retains approximately 60% of this finish with some light freckling. Cylinder has been cleaned to match and retains no original finish. All numbers match including wedge and lever. Original grips retain a large percentage of the original varnish with no cracks or chips. 30-40% original plating on back strap and trigger guard. Action is perfect. Strong clean bore. Tinned Colts were popular with the sea service. This revolver is housed in a vintage re-purposed box. Has a reproduction silver plated flask, old German turn screw, Colt two cavity bullet mold, steel, and an old cap tin.
